How the page works

How to read the score

Tone is directional

It describes the weighted balance of qualifying headlines. A score of 50 can mean a balanced tape or that direction has been withheld for insufficient evidence; the status label distinguishes them.

Confidence is separate

Confidence measures depth, source breadth, direct relevance, freshness and agreement. It does not rise merely because the tone is extreme.

Price is confirmation

Weekly price response, trend and fair-value position test whether the market is accepting or rejecting the news. They never rewrite the news score.

Classification, not prediction

The page describes completed evidence available at the stated time. It is research context, not a forecast, recommendation, target or execution instruction.
